当前位置:首页 > 编程技术 > 正文

c语言程序设计测试数据如何写

c语言程序设计测试数据如何写

在C语言程序设计中,测试数据是用来验证程序正确性的输入数据。编写测试数据时,你应该考虑以下几个方面:1. 正常情况:这是最基本的情况,用来验证程序在正常输入下的行为是否...

在C语言程序设计中,测试数据是用来验证程序正确性的输入数据。编写测试数据时,你应该考虑以下几个方面:

1. 正常情况:这是最基本的情况,用来验证程序在正常输入下的行为是否符合预期。

2. 边界情况:测试程序在输入值达到边界时的行为,比如最小值、最大值、零、空字符串等。

3. 异常情况:测试程序对异常输入的处理能力,比如非法字符、空指针、非预期的数据类型等。

4. 性能测试:如果需要,还可以编写测试数据来评估程序的性能,比如大数输入、大量数据输入等。

以下是一些编写测试数据的示例:

示例1:计算平均值

假设有一个函数`calculate_average`,它接受三个整数参数并返回平均值。

```c

include

double calculate_average(int a, int b, int c) {

return (a + b + c) / 3.0;

最新文章